Apply for a Google Summer of code 2009 with Debian Med!
March 28th, 2009
The Debian project has been accepted as a mentor organisation for the Google Summer of Code 2009, and two of the proposed projects are directly related Debian Med:
-
The Large dataset manager consists in building an application to automate the downloading, upgrading and indexing of large datasets, such as genomes, gene models, and other curated datasets in the case of bioinformatics. The large dataset manager will be especially useful in conjunction with programs already packaged in Debian that are capable to index datasets, such as EMBOSS or NCBI Blast.
-
The Blends Webtools consists in enhancing the Debian Pure Blends webtools by using the Ultimate Debian Database. The Debian Pure Blends is the framework used by the Debian Med to produce its thematic meta-packages and monitor all packages related to biology and medicine in Debian, and the Ultimate Debian Database is a novel convergence point of information for Debian, developed during last year's Google Summer of Code.
The other projects proposed by Debian this year are related to packaging, the Debian installer, our bug tracking system, our infrastructure for building binary packages, our archive, and websites.
